What is vector quantities?

Respuesta :

topeadeniran2 topeadeniran2
  • 04-04-2020

Answer: Vector quantity is a measurement that has both magnitude and direction.

Explanation:

Vector quantity is a measurement that has both magnitude and direction. Examples are force, acceleration, displacement and velocity.
